Please Note: The Sverker 750 Basic is not supplied with the test lead set and transport case The Megger Sverker 750 Relay Test Set is the engineer's toolbox. The control panel features a logical layout, SVERKER 650 users will find it comfortably familiar and will be able to start work right away. The Programma Sverker 750 features many functions that make relay testing more efficient. For example, its powerful measurement section can display (in addition to time, voltage and current) Z, R, X, S, P, Q, phase angle and cos. The voltmeter can also be used as a 2nd ammeter (when testing differential relays for example). All values are presented on a single easy-to-read display. The current source built into the Sverker750 can provide 0-10A, 0-40A, 0-100A, 0-250V AC or 0-300V DC. Designed to comply with EU standards and other personal and operational safety standards, the SVERKER750 is also equipped with a serial port for communication with personal computers and the PC software SVERKER Win. SINGLE-PHASE RELAY TESTING APPLICATIONS: Overcurrent relays. Inverse time overcurrent relays. Undercurrent relays. Ground fault relays. Directional overcurrent relays. Directional ground fault relays. Overvoltage relays. Undervoltage relays. Directional power relays. Power factor relays. Differential protection (differential circuits). Distance protection equipment (phase by phase). Negative sequence overcurrent relays. Motor overload protection. Automatic reclosing devices. Tripping relays. Voltage regulating relays. Underimpedance relays. Thermal relays. Time-delay relays. Sverker750 Extra Features: Plotting excitation curves. Current and voltage transformer ratio tests. Burden measurement for protective relay test equipment. Impedance measurement. Efficiency tests. Polarity (direction) tests. Injection: Maintained, Momentary & Max. time. Filtering: When filtering is selected, five successive readings are averaged. Off delay: The turning off of generation can be delayed after tripping.
